Mr. Apirak unveils his advisory team
September 30th, 2008 - 4:29 pm ICT by Amrit RashmisrisethiBangkok governor candidate Apirak Kosayothin (อภิรักษ์ โกษะโยธิน), also an MP from Democrat Party, has unveiled 18 names who will join his advisory team.
Mr. Apirak says members of his team include economists, medical personnel, architects, engineers, financiers, marketers and representatives of handicaps. He views the policies, which will be applied to develop Bangkok Metropolis in five aspects, require cooperation from all sides. He assures that members in his advisory team are competent and have experiences in required fields to develop Bangkok.
Mr. Apirak says his deputy will be named after he is elected. He suggests that his disclosure of advisory team’s names show his readiness and will contribute his knowledge from his past experience to administrate Bangkok. He insists he is ready to work for the public members.
